Exploring the Best Silver Wire Mesh Applications, Benefits, and Selection Guide


Silver wire mesh, celebrated for its unique properties and a wide range of applications, has steadily gained popularity in various industries. This article delves into what silver wire mesh is, its advantages, applications, and criteria for selecting the best silver wire mesh for your needs.


What is Silver Wire Mesh?


Silver wire mesh is a textile-like material made from finely woven strands of silver. It combines the unique properties of silver — such as conductivity, antimicrobial effects, and durability — with the versatility of mesh design. Available in different weaves, densities, and strand diameters, silver wire mesh can be tailored to meet specific project requirements.


Benefits of Silver Wire Mesh


1. Conductivity One of the most significant advantages of silver is its remarkable electrical conductivity. Silver wire mesh is widely used in electronic applications where efficient conduction and minimal resistance are crucial.


2. Antimicrobial Properties Silver has long been recognized for its natural antimicrobial properties. Silver wire mesh is effective in inhibiting the growth of bacteria, fungi, and viruses, making it ideal for medical applications and environments where hygiene is paramount.


3. Durability Silver is inherently resistant to corrosion and tarnishing, which contributes to the longevity of silver wire mesh products. This makes it suitable for harsh environments and enhances the lifespan of devices in which it is embedded.


4. Aesthetic Appeal The lustrous finish of silver wire mesh adds a touch of sophistication, making it a popular choice in decorative applications as well as functional ones.


5. Flexibility and Versatility Silver wire mesh can be manufactured in a wide range of sizes and specifications, making it suitable for applications in various fields, including electronics, medical devices, filtration, and art.


Applications of Silver Wire Mesh


1. Electronics In the electronics sector, silver wire mesh is used as a conductive layer in touchscreens, sensors, and flexible circuit boards. Its high conductivity ensures efficient energy transfer and signal reliability.


2. Medical Devices Due to its antimicrobial properties, silver wire mesh is commonly utilized in surgical instruments, wound dressings, and medical implants. It helps reduce the risk of infection while providing structural support.

3. Filtration Silver wire mesh can be used in filters for air and liquids, particularly in applications where sterility is essential. Its ability to trap particulate matter while allowing fluid flow makes it an effective filtration medium.


4. Architectural Features The aesthetic quality of silver mesh lends itself to applications in architecture and interior design. Designers use silver wire mesh in ceiling panels, room dividers, and decorative accents to create unique visual effects.


5. Fashion and Art The flexible and lightweight nature of silver mesh has also found its way into the fashion industry, where it is used to create avant-garde jewelry and accessories. Artists utilize silver mesh to add texture and depth to sculptures and installations.


Selecting the Best Silver Wire Mesh


When choosing the best silver wire mesh for your project, consider the following factors


1. Material Purity Higher purity levels (usually 92.5% or above) result in better performance. Ensure you are sourcing from reputable suppliers who provide certification of material quality.


2. Mesh Size Determine the required mesh size for your application. Finer meshes are suitable for filtration and electronics, while coarser meshes may be used for structural applications.


3. Weave Type Different weave types (twill, plain, or satin) offer varying levels of flexibility, strength, and appearance. Select a weave type aligning with your project requirements.


4. Corrosion Resistance Although silver is naturally resistant to corrosion, consider additional treatments that enhance its durability in specific environments.


5. Cost Silver wire mesh can be more expensive than alternatives. Ensure that the benefits align with your budget and application needs.
